On Mon, Aug 1, 2011 at 6:46 PM, David Fetter <david@fetter.org> wrote: > On Sat, Jul 30, 2011 at 08:32:03PM +0100, Dave Page wrote: >> On Sat, Jul 30, 2011 at 8:25 PM, Tom Lane <tgl@sss.pgh.pa.us> wrote: >> > I think you had better plan on incorporating GNU readline into >> > installer builds for Lion. >> >> Unfortunately the licence makes that a non-starter. > > What is it about a GPLed psql client that is a non-starter for the > installer? I'm not a fan of the GPL, but in this case, the effects of > linking it in are quite limited in scope, i.e. they pertain to exactly > one binary. The scope or number of files is irrelevant. Having just a single GPL'd file in those installers makes it impossible for ISVs to bundle them with their products, unless they open source them under a GPL compatible licence. -- Dave Page Blog: http://pgsnake.blogspot.com Twitter: @pgsnake EnterpriseDB UK: http://www.enterprisedb.com The Enterprise PostgreSQL Company
